Training Programme Director– Otolaryngology (ENT) - Education Lead

The role of the Education Lead is to work with and support the Postgraduate Dean and Training Program Director (TPD) in leading and the delivering regional educational content in line with the current curriculum set out by the JCHST in Otolaryngology.

Main duties of the job

The Otolaryngology (ENT) Education Lead is a member of the Speciality Training Committee (STC) who is managerially responsible to the Postgraduate Dean for the delivery of training in that speciality according to the standards set by the GMC and the Royal College of Surgeons.

The role includes organising and coordinating the regional teaching and training programme to enhance curriculum delivery. This involves arranging speakers, uploading approved educational content to the new PGVLE website, and collecting and reviewing feedback. The postholder will liaise with and delegate responsibilities to appropriate hospital sites for educational training camps, maintain accurate records of all regional educational events and courses (including dissection courses), and present updates and feedback at the STC meetings twice yearly.

The demands on the Education Lead are likely to vary at times, and the guidance below should be interpreted flexibly.
